
Introduction
DevOps has become a key component in the tech industry, revolutionizing the way software is developed, tested, and deployed. It focuses on collaboration and communication between developers and IT operations to streamline the software delivery process. Release management is a critical aspect of DevOps, ensuring that changes are deployed successfully and efficiently. As an experienced SEO and content writer, I have seen firsthand how DevOps can greatly improve release management processes for tech and marketing teams. In this post, we will explore how to use DevOps to improve release management and how platforms like Baaraku can help source top talent for your DevOps teams.
Understanding DevOps
DevOps is a methodology that combines software development (Dev) with IT operations (Ops) to shorten the systems development life cycle and provide continuous delivery of high-quality software. It emphasizes collaboration, automation, and integration between development and operations teams to improve the speed and quality of software delivery. By breaking down silos and fostering a culture of collaboration, DevOps enables teams to deliver faster, more reliable software releases.
Improving Release Management with DevOps
Release management is the process of planning, scheduling, and controlling the deployment of software releases to production environments. It involves coordinating tasks across development, testing, and operations teams to ensure that changes are deployed smoothly and efficiently. DevOps can greatly improve release management processes by incorporating automation, continuous integration, and continuous delivery practices.
Automation plays a key role in DevOps by eliminating manual tasks and streamlining the software delivery process. By automating repetitive tasks such as testing, building, and deploying code, teams can release software faster and with fewer errors. Continuous integration involves merging code changes into a shared repository frequently, allowing teams to detect and address integration issues early on. Continuous delivery extends this concept by automating the deployment of code changes to production environments, enabling teams to release software updates quickly and reliably.
By implementing these DevOps practices, teams can achieve faster release cycles, improved quality, and greater efficiency in their release management processes. DevOps also promotes collaboration and communication between teams, fostering a culture of shared responsibility and accountability for the software delivery process.
The Role of Baaraku in Sourcing DevOps Talent
As a tech and marketing agency, Baaraku specializes in connecting businesses with top talent in the industry. When it comes to building a successful DevOps team, having the right talent is crucial. Baaraku offers a platform where businesses can find skilled professionals who are well-versed in DevOps practices and methodologies.
By partnering with Baaraku, businesses can access a pool of experienced DevOps engineers, developers, and operations specialists who can help streamline their release management processes. Baaraku’s platform allows businesses to search for and hire DevOps talent based on their specific requirements and skill sets. Whether you are looking for experts in automation, continuous integration, or deployment, Baaraku can help you find the right fit for your team.
Additionally, Baaraku provides support and resources for businesses looking to build and scale their DevOps teams. From expert guidance on best practices to training and development opportunities, Baaraku can help businesses enhance their DevOps capabilities and drive innovation in their software delivery processes.
Benefits of Using Baaraku for DevOps Talent
There are several benefits to using Baaraku to source DevOps talent for your team:
- Access to top talent: Baaraku’s platform connects businesses with skilled professionals who have the expertise and experience to drive success in DevOps.
- Customized recruitment: Businesses can tailor their search for DevOps talent based on their specific needs and requirements, ensuring a perfect fit for their team.
- Support and resources: Baaraku offers ongoing support and resources for businesses looking to build and optimize their DevOps teams, including training and development opportunities.
- Scalability: Baaraku can help businesses scale their DevOps teams as needed, allowing for flexibility and agility in meeting changing business demands.
By leveraging Baaraku’s platform and resources, businesses can build high-performing DevOps teams that drive innovation, efficiency, and success in their release management processes.
Best Practices for Using DevOps in Release Management
When it comes to using DevOps to improve release management, there are several best practices to keep in mind:
- Collaboration: Foster collaboration and communication between development and operations teams to streamline the software delivery process.
- Automation: Implement automation tools and practices to eliminate manual tasks and speed up the release cycle.
- Continuous integration: Enable continuous integration practices to merge code changes frequently and detect integration issues early on.
- Continuous delivery: Automate the deployment of code changes to production environments to release software updates quickly and reliably.
- Monitoring and feedback: Implement monitoring tools to track the performance of releases and gather feedback for continuous improvement.
By following these best practices and leveraging DevOps principles, businesses can enhance their release management processes and achieve faster, more reliable software delivery.
Conclusion
DevOps has transformed the way software is developed, tested, and deployed, offering a more efficient and streamlined approach to release management. By incorporating automation, continuous integration, and continuous delivery practices, teams can release software faster and with higher quality. Platforms like Baaraku provide businesses with access to top DevOps talent, allowing them to build high-performing teams that drive success in their release management processes.
By following best practices and leveraging DevOps principles, businesses can enhance their release management processes, drive innovation, and achieve greater efficiency in their software delivery. With DevOps and platforms like Baaraku, businesses can stay ahead of the curve and unlock new opportunities for growth and success in the tech and marketing industry.
FAQs about DevOps and Release Management
How to Use DevOps to Improve Release Management
Why Baaraku.io is the Perfect Source for Hiring Remote and Local IT and Marketing Talents
When it comes to finding top-notch IT and marketing talents for your business, Baaraku.io is the ultimate platform to turn to. Whether you are looking to hire remote professionals or local talents, Baaraku.io offers a wide pool of skilled individuals ready to take on your projects.
With a seamless and user-friendly interface, Baaraku.io makes it easy for founders and businesses to connect with talented individuals who can bring their visions to life. From web developers to digital marketers, Baaraku.io has professionals in various fields, ensuring that you find the perfect match for your specific needs.
Conclusion
Don’t waste your time searching for IT and marketing talents elsewhere. Baaraku.io is the go-to platform for founders and businesses looking to hire top-notch remote and local professionals. With a diverse range of talents at your fingertips, Baaraku.io will help you build a strong and successful team for your business.
